Counting Calories
Many diet plans that are effective in helping people lose weight are based on counting calories. If you keep track of your calorie intake and pay attention to how
many calories you consume - based on how much you burn off - you will be able to control your weight gain.
On average, women need about 2,000 calories per day, and men need about 2,700 calories. Of course many factors influence the number of calories each
person needs. Increasing the number of calories consumed per day on a consistent basis will often lead to weight gain. Of course if you burn off more
calories than you consume by regular exercise you can control this.
